Changes from Live 7.0.2b6 to Live 7.0.2


Bug fixes:

Dragging in certain audio files, already analyzed in previous version of Live, could lead to a crash.
http://www.ableton.com/forum/viewtopic.php?t=84178

The Temp directory would not removed when doing ‘New Live set’ and the current set has armed tracks.

Clips of frozen track could not moved or copied to other track. This bug was introduced with Live 7.0.2b6
